WATCH: Ariz. Cop Runs Down Suspect With Cruiser

An Arizona police department released a video Tuesday that shows a patrol car plowing into an armed suspect who police said had been on a day-long crime spree. Marana police say Mario Valencia allegedly robbed a 7-Eleven, started a fire at a church, broke into a home and stole a car. The 36-year-old then drove to Walmart, where he allegedly swiped a rifle and ammunition. In the dashboard camera video, a gunshot is heard as Valencia is seen walking down the street before Officer Michael Rapiejko slams a police cruiser into him, sending the man flying into the air. Valencia's attorney, Michelle Metzger, called the unconventional tactic "shocking," and "clearly excessive police force." Valencia survived the crash, and prosecutors cleared the officer of any wrongdoing.
